The Hidden Impact: How Dehydration Can Affect Your Mental Health - Water is the elixir of life, essential for the functioning of every cell, tissue, and organ in our bodies. While the physical ramifications of dehydration are well-documented, its effects on mental health often go unnoticed. Yet, research increasingly suggests a profound connection between hydration and psychological well-being. In this article, we explore how the lack of water can lead to psychological disturbances and even psychosis. Understanding Dehydration Dehydration occurs when the body loses more fluids than it takes in. This imbalance disrupts essential bodily functions, impacting not only physical health but also cognitive abilities and emotional stability. Mild dehydration can cause symptoms such as thirst, dry mouth, fatigue, and headaches. However, prolonged or severe dehydration can have far-reaching consequences, including significant effects on mental health. The Brain's Dependence on Water The human brain is composed of approximately 75% water, making it particularly vulnerable to fluctuations in hydration levels. Water plays a crucial role in maintaining optimal brain function by regulating neurotransmitter production, facilitating nerve transmission, and removing metabolic waste. When deprived of adequate hydration, the brain struggles to perform these vital functions, leading to a cascade of cognitive and emotional disturbances. Dehydration and Cognitive Decline Research indicates that even mild dehydration can impair cognitive performance, including attention, memory, and executive function. Studies have shown that dehydrated individuals exhibit reduced cognitive processing speed, poorer short-term memory retention, and increased difficulty concentrating on tasks. These cognitive deficits can significantly impact daily functioning and productivity, contributing to feelings of frustration and inadequacy. The Link to Psychological Distress In addition to cognitive impairments, dehydration can exacerbate psychological distress and mood disturbances. Dehydrated individuals are more likely to experience symptoms of anxiety, irritability, and low mood compared to their well-hydrated counterparts. These emotional changes stem from alterations in neurotransmitter activity and hormonal imbalances triggered by dehydration. Chronic dehydration may even contribute to the development or exacerbation of mood disorders such as depression. Psychosis: A Severe Consequence At the extreme end of the spectrum, severe dehydration has been linked to psychotic symptoms, including hallucinations, delusions, and disorganized thinking. While rare, cases of dehydration-induced psychosis have been documented in medical literature, particularly among individuals with pre-existing mental health conditions or substance abuse issues. Dehydration-induced psychosis underscores the critical importance of maintaining adequate fluid intake for both physical and mental well-being. Protecting Mental Health through Hydration Given the profound impact of dehydration on mental health, prioritizing adequate fluid intake is essential for safeguarding psychological well-being. Here are some strategies to ensure optimal hydration: Drink Water Regularly: Aim to consume at least eight glasses of water per day, and more if you engage in strenuous physical activity or live in a hot climate. Monitor Hydration Levels: Pay attention to signs of dehydration, such as thirst, dark urine, dry skin, and fatigue. Drink water throughout the day, even if you don't feel thirsty. Limit Dehydrating Beverages: Minimize intake of caffeinated and alcoholic beverages, which can increase fluid loss and contribute to dehydration. Eat Water-Rich Foods: Incorporate hydrating foods such as fruits, vegetables, and soups into your diet to supplement your fluid intake. Hydrate During Exercise: Drink water before, during, and after physical activity to replenish fluids lost through sweat. Conclusion Water is not just essential for quenching thirst and sustaining bodily functions; it is also critical for maintaining optimal mental health. Dehydration can impair cognitive performance, exacerbate psychological distress, and in severe cases, precipitate psychosis. By prioritizing hydration and adopting healthy fluid intake habits, individuals can protect their mental well-being and promote overall vitality. Remember, when it comes to hydration, it's not just about staying physically healthy—it's about nurturing your mind as well.

Introduction

In the world of entertainment, some artists possess a rare combination of talent, charisma, and dedication that propels them to stardom. One such artist is Ben Platt, whose meteoric rise in the music industry has captivated audiences around the globe. Known for his incredible vocal prowess, heartfelt lyrics, and undeniable stage presence, Ben Platt has become a household name. In this article, we’ll take a closer look at the life and career of this remarkable musician.

The Early Years

Ben Platt was born on September 24, 1993, in Los Angeles, California, into a family deeply rooted in the world of entertainment. His father, Marc Platt, is a renowned producer, and his mother, Julie Beren, is a talented actress and pianist. Growing up in such an artistic environment undoubtedly played a significant role in shaping Ben’s passion for music and performance.

Musical Theater Breakthrough

Platt’s journey to fame began on the Broadway stage. In 2012, he landed a role in the musical comedy “Pitch Perfect,” where he showcased his singing abilities. However, it was his role as Evan Hansen in the critically acclaimed musical “Dear Evan Hansen” that truly launched his career into the stratosphere. His emotionally charged performance earned him a Tony Award for Best Actor in a Leading Role in a Musical, making him one of the youngest actors to ever receive this prestigious honor.

Transition to the Music Industry

After his success on Broadway, Ben Platt made the bold move into the music industry. His debut studio album, “Sing to Me Instead,” was released in March 2019, and it quickly became evident that his musical talents extended far beyond the theater. The album featured deeply personal and emotional songs that showcased his incredible vocal range and songwriting skills. Tracks like “Grow As We Go” and “Bad Habit” resonated with audiences, earning him critical acclaim and a dedicated fan base.

A Star on the Rise

Ben Platt’s music career continued to soar, with sold-out tours and appearances on major talk shows and music festivals. His performance of “Somewhere” from “West Side Story” at the 2020 Grammy Awards left audiences in awe and further solidified his status as a musical force to be reckoned with.

Social Impact and Advocacy

Beyond his music and acting career, Ben Platt has used his platform to advocate for important social causes. He is openly gay and has been an advocate for LGBTQ+ rights and mental health awareness. His willingness to speak openly about his own experiences has inspired and empowered many individuals facing similar challenges.

Looking Ahead

As Ben Platt’s career continues to evolve, it’s clear that he has a bright future ahead. His dedication to his craft, authenticity, and powerful performances have won over the hearts of fans and critics alike. Whether on stage, in the recording studio, or as an advocate for social change, Ben Platt is undoubtedly a rising star who will continue to make a significant impact on the entertainment industry for years to come.

Conclusion

Ben Platt’s journey from the Broadway stage to the music industry is a testament to his exceptional talent and unwavering dedication. His ability to connect with audiences through his music and performances has solidified his place as one of the most promising young artists in the industry today. As he continues to create heartfelt and powerful music, there is no doubt that Ben Platt’s star will continue to rise, leaving an indelible mark on the world of entertainment.
